Panoramic Vision Mine Safety Monitoring System Based on WLAN

Article Preview

Abstract:

For the requirements of complex environment and safe-management in the coal mine, this paper presents a new Panoramic Vision Mine Safety Monitoring System Based on WLAN. the monitoring system use a binocular omni-directional vision sensor(ODVS)[1] coordinated with the WLAN or LAN network to transmit images, information, commands or data. The system can also get the panoramic vision in the coal mine from any miner at any time. The miners’ identities will be binding with the ODVS and WLAN protocol. Then the monitoring system will use the binding information to position and track miners. This is a new reliable monitoring system which can monitor the coal mine environment security, the coal mine producing security, the coal mine transport security, the miner security at the same time, and these provide the system with expecting application value and market outlook.
